Introduction
Collaboration has been an integral part of all major researches for a long time.
Over the years the nature of collaboration has evolved from a narrow, intra departmental collaboration effort to a massive interdisciplinary multi contextual, inter organizational and even global collaboration
Such efforts have started yielding significant ground breaking results and has helped cover complex, and convoluted areas

Share of Total Global R&D Spending
Region / Country 2011 2012 2013
Americas (21) 34.8% 34.3% 33.8%
U.S. 29.6% 29.0% 28.3%
Asia (20) 34.9% 36.0% 37.1%
Japan 11.2% 11.1% 10.8%
China 12.7% 13.7% 14.7%
India 2.8% 2.8% 3.0%
Europe (34) 24.6% 24.0% 23.4%
Rest of World (36) 5.7% 5.7% 5.7%
Source: Battelle, R&D Magazine
